1973 BMW Touring vs. 1995 Chrysler Sebring
To start off, 1995 Chrysler Sebring is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 BMW Touring.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 BMW Touring would be higher. At 2,489 cc (6 cylinders), 1995 Chrysler Sebring is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1995 Chrysler Sebring (161 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 76 more horse power than 1973 BMW Touring. (85 HP @ 5700 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1995 Chrysler Sebring should accelerate faster than 1973 BMW Touring.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Chrysler Sebring weights approximately 280 kg more than 1973 BMW Touring.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
